My Pond Fountain Pump Keeps Get Blocked By Duckweed Stems, What Can I Do To Stop It?

    Aeration (pumping air into your pond with an electric pump or windmill) will help reduce some of the nutrient levels in your pond that the duckweed relies on for its explosive growth. Pond bacteria (such as BactaPur) will also remove the high levels of nutrients in the water.
